Nikolay S. KOVALENKO
ON THE QUESTION OF THE DATING AND CIRCUMSTANCES OF THE INITIAL SETTLEMENT OF THE STANITSA OF GUBSKOYA AT THE FINAL STAGE OF THE CAUCASIAN WAR
This article, using archival and published documents, examines the circumstances surrounding the appearance of the village of Gubskaya on the map of the Trans-Kuban region in 1861. The author analyzes the numerical, gender, age, and religious composition of the intended and actual first settlers of this settlement, outlining the circle of individuals who contributed to its development and settlement. Particular attention is given to the little-known figure of Ensign E.P. Zabolotsky, who was responsible for transporting hunter-settlers to the Gubs River. Using this officer's service record, introduced into scholarly circulation for the first time, the author reconstructs the circumstances of his military career prior to 1861 and demonstrates his involvement in the fates of the voluntary settlers prior to their arrival at the settlement point. In conclusion, the need for continued research is noted to more accurately date the settlement of Gubskaya, which, as can now be confirmed, occurred in late July – early August 1861. An important visual addition to the work is the demographic tables and age-sex pyramids of the first Gubskaya settlers, compiled by the author based on archival materials. Soltan I. SALPAGAROV
FEATURES OF THE FUNCTIONING OF THE DISTRICT LEVEL OF PARTY ADMINISTRATION IN KARACHAY-CHERKESSIA DURING THE NEP PERIOD (THE FIRST HALF OF THE 1920s)
In the presented article, the author examines certain aspects of the history of the organizational construction of the organs of the Russian Communist Party of the Bolsheviks (RCP/b/) in the territory of Karachay-Cherkessia during the period of the new economic policy. Highlighting the early stage of the formation of the RCP (b0) apparatus in the region, the author points out that the middle link of the party administration was in its infancy and was represented by only one official position in the person of the authorized Karachay-Cherkess regional organizational Bureau (Orgburo) for a particular district (district). The objective reasons for the weakness of this link are noted, which consisted primarily in the small number of RCP(b) members in rural areas and the extremely limited budget resources of the regional party organization. The article highlights the functions of the institute of commissioners, including control over the activities of the primary organizations of the Russian Communist Party (b) (party cells in settlements and institutions), district structures of the Komsomol, interaction with the executive bodies of the Councils of Deputies, participation in joint commissions with them, general supervision of the socio-political and socio-economic situation in the district, the work of educational institutions., cultural, cooperative, and trade union structures.

Kirill A. DOLGOPOLOV, Elizaveta V. DANILOVA
THE INFLUENCE OF PUBLIC OPINION ON THE FORMATION AND APPLICATION OF CRIMINAL PUNISHMENT
The article examines the influence of public opinion on the formation and application of criminal punishment. The attitude to criminal punishment is considered within the framework of such theories as social control and stigmatization theory. The theory of social control, the attitude to criminal punishment depends on the level of social control that exists in society. It is shown that according to the theory of social control, if control is high, then the attitude to criminal punishment may be more positive, since people will feel that laws are observed and that they are protected from criminals. On the other hand, if control is low, then the attitude to criminal punishment may be more negative, since members of society feel unprotected and unsure of the legality of the system.
It is shown that public opinion is not the only and main factor influencing the formation and application of criminal punishment. Decisions in this area are made on the basis of a comprehensive analysis of various factors, including legal and moral norms, economic interests, political beliefs, etc.
Public opinion has an influence on the formation and application of criminal punishment, but this influence can be limited and depends on many factors. Further research in this area will help to determine more precisely how public opinion influences criminal justice decision-making and how this influence can be strengthened or weakened.

Irina V. KIREEVA, Marianna A. MELGOSH, Elizabeth S. MIRONOVA, Diana D. TSOI
PERSONAL SPACE: THE SEARCH FOR THEORETICAL AND METHODOLOGICAL FOUNDATIONS FOR DEFINING ITS BOUNDARIES IN THE CONTEXT OF THE DEVELOPMENT OF DIGITAL TECHNOLOGIES
The article discusses various theoretical and methodological approaches to the study of personal space boundaries: psychological, legal, cultural, and sociological. By revealing the dynamics of perceptions of personal space boundaries, the authors address the current stage of society's development, where rapid advancements in digital technologies, globalization, and the importance of security, self-determination, and privacy have become crucial factors. In the post-industrial era, personal space boundaries have undergone significant changes, encompassing not only the physical realm of human life (offline) but also the virtual realm (online). Consequently, there is a need to establish new boundaries and understand how the current generation perceives them. The analysis of existing approaches has led to the development of a system of empirical indicators for the change in personal space boundaries, which includes: 1) the level of user activity; 2) the level of digital culture; 3) the level of interpersonal and institutional trust; 4) the level of sensitivity to privacy violations; 5) the formation of digital identity; 6) the level of loyalty and openness to innovation. Based on these indicators, a mass survey of the population will be conducted in the future. This survey will provide relevant empirical data on how individuals from different socio-demographic groups define personal space boundaries, the role of online space within them, and how digital technologies are influencing the modern world.

Emir N. TUZHBA, Angela A. BEZRUKOVA
CAUCASIAN COMMUNITIES: SOCIO-CULTURAL SPECIFICITIES
This article examines he socio-cultural specifics of ethnic communities with an emphasis on the mentality of the peoples of the Caucasus in the context of historical, cultural, natural and geographical factors. The main theoretical approaches to the concept of mentality, including primordialism, constructivism and a sociobiological approach, are analyzed, and the interdisciplinary nature of the issues under study is emphasized. Special attention is paid to the influence of the natural environment on the formation of ethnic identity and social structures, as well as the relationship between traditional norms, legal awareness and collective self-identification. It is noted that the natural conditions, in particular the mountainous landscape, significantly affected the social stratification and economic dependence of the highlanders on the lowland population, which has the best resources for agricultural activities. Despite the fact that in modern conditions such dependence is rather symbolic in nature, its cultural heritage continues to influence social attitudes.
The features of ethnic consolidation, legal ambivalence, ethnogenetic connections and cultural codes of the peoples of the North Caucasus are highlighted. The conclusion is made about the importance of the natural landscape, interethnic interactions and historical memory in the formation of stable mental attitudes and socio-cultural patterns of behavior.
